A punchline, a plane ticket, and a hallway recording in Boracay turned into a realisation: learning lands differently when you leave your routine. Aly and Andrew share how destination conferences change your headspace, why paying to be present makes you listen harder, and the simple systems that let you unplug without everything unravelling back home.They break down a practical roadmap for disconnecting before you go that can stop surprise escalations and resentment. You’ll hear how handwritten notes and short reflection windows lock in retention, plus a lightweight process to digitise, summarise, and turn takeaways that you and your team can actually ship.Beyond the stage, we go deep on the art of conference connection. From beach networking to awards-night chats. Big firms and small shops alike face the same patterns at different scales; drop the ego and the room becomes a library.
